Title:
SYSTEMS AND METHODS FOR TRANSCUTANEOUS DIRECT CURRENT BLOCK TO ALTER NERVE CONDUCTION

Abstract:
To provide, in one aspect, a system that can alter conduction (tDCB) in a nerve by transcutaneous DC application (e.g., blocking or attenuation).SOLUTION: The system can include a current generator that generates a DC. A first skin electrode can be coupled to the current generator to deliver the DC transcutaneously through a target nerve to a second skin electrode. Conduction in the target nerve is directly altered as a result of an electric field generated in response to the DC.SELECTED DRAWING: Figure 1
